Swiss International University (SIU), founded in 1999, continues to reinforce its position as a truly international higher education institution, combining Swiss academic tradition with global accessibility. With more than 3,800 students from over 120 countries, SIU today stands as a dynamic, multi-campus university system operating across Europe, the GCC, and Asia.

From its early beginnings in Switzerland to becoming a globally connected institution, SIU has steadily expanded its reach while maintaining a clear academic mission: to deliver flexible, internationally recognized education aligned with quality, innovation, and professional relevance.


A Global University with Swiss Roots

Headquartered in Switzerland and legally registered under Swiss private law, SIU is authorized to provide academic teaching and issue its own diplomas. Its business and hospitality education activities are allowed by the Cantonal Department of Education and Culture in Switzerland, reflecting its alignment with Swiss educational standards.

Since 2013, SIU has been offering structured online education, long before digital learning became mainstream. Today, the university operates campuses and academic centers in:

  • Switzerland: Zurich, Lucerne

  • Latvia: Riga

  • United Kingdom: London

  • United Arab Emirates: Dubai and Ajman

  • Kyrgyzstan: Bishkek and Osh

This geographic diversity allows SIU to combine European academic heritage with strong engagement in emerging markets across the Gulf region and Central Asia.


Strategic Expansion Under VBNN Smart Education Group

In 2025, SIU entered a new phase of growth through strategic acquisitions under the umbrella of VBNN Smart Education Group. These included:

  • ISBM Business School Lucerne

  • AAHES Autonomous Academy of Higher Education in Zurich

  • ISB Institute Dubai

  • OUS Academy London

  • Amber Academy Riga

These acquisitions have strengthened SIU’s academic portfolio in business, management, hospitality, and professional education, further integrating its European and international operations.

Official Recognition and Regulatory Approvals

Swiss International University operates with multiple layers of recognition and approval across jurisdictions:

  • Accredited as a full university by the Ministry of Education in Kyrgyzstan, representing the highest category of academic licensing within that system.

  • Registered by the Ministry of Justice in Kyrgyzstan.

  • Approved by KHDA in Dubai as a vocational and professional education institute.

  • Officially registered in the United Kingdom Register of Learning Providers (UKRLP) for professional education and CPD activities.

All SIU degrees are issued in accordance with applicable regulations in their respective jurisdictions and are provided with Apostille legalization where applicable, supporting international document recognition processes.

Students also benefit from a multi-jurisdictional academic structure. Depending on their program pathway, learners may obtain qualifications linked to Kyrgyzstan, Switzerland, and Dubai, along with professional certificates from the UK branch.


International Accreditations and Quality Recognition

SIU maintains several international accreditations and quality recognitions that support its global credibility:

  • ECLBS (European Council of Leading Business Schools) – A European accreditation body focusing on academic standards, research quality, and institutional development within business education.

  • ASIC (Accreditation Service for International Schools, Colleges and Universities, UK) – A British-based accreditation body recognized for assessing institutional governance, student support, and operational standards.

  • ARIA (Uzbekistan) – Supporting regional academic alignment and quality benchmarking.

  • EDU Intergovernmental Accreditation – Promoting cross-border educational cooperation.

  • BSKG Asia Accreditation – Enhancing academic standards within Asian education networks.

  • TAG-Eduqa (Arab Accreditation) – Supporting institutional quality development in Arabic-speaking regions.

  • ISO 21001 – The international management system standard specifically designed for educational organizations.

In addition, SIU holds other recognitions such as QAHE and IEAC (International Education Accreditation Council), although the university’s focus remains on structured institutional quality and measurable outcomes.

SIU is also a member of the Swiss Association for Quality (SAQ), reflecting its engagement with Swiss quality culture and professional standards.
